UAE Sheiks Making Moves Into English Soccer
Abu Dhabi billionaire Sulaiman Al-Fahim, CEO of developer Hydra Properties, bought Manchester City Football Club from former Thai Prime Minister Thaksin Shinawatra, who was forced to sell the team after Thailand froze his assets. The cost, £200 million ($360 million), is insignificant for al-Fahim, who is funded by the Crown Prince of Abu Dhabi, Sheik […]
Virtual fundraising reaches audience of 14 million
An online videogame played by millions of people worldwide has been turned into an important fundraising tool for charity. Students in Singapore have transformed the game, Second Life, into a fundraising utility for the charity National University Hospital’s Blood and Marrow Transplant 4 Kids by allowing the game’s players to donate funds virtually.
